Forward-angle charged-pion electroproduction in the deuteron

A direct experimental determination has been made of the ratio of the forward-angle positive-pion electroproduction cross section for a proton bound in the deuteron with that of a free proton for invariant masses of 1160 and 1232 MeV. A significant quenching of the reaction in the deuteron is observed.
